12. If a number is selected at random from the list above, what is the probability that it will be less than 4?
Answer: B
The probability that a randomly selected number from the list will be less than 4 is 1/2.
In the given list (0, 1, 2, 3, 4, 5, 6, 7), the numbers that are less than 4 are 0, 1, 2, and 3. This results in 4 favorable outcomes out of a total of 8 numbers, leading to a probability of 4/8, which simplifies to 1/2.
